Budget Time & the Tin-Cupped Performing Arts

Ramli Ibrahim, Sutra House | Izan Satrina Mohd Salleh, My Performing Arts Agency

20-Oct-16 14:30

Budget Time & the Tin-Cupped Performing Arts

As it is time for Budget 2017, we gathered a couple of notables from the industry to tell us what they think the Government might offer to the arts--in particular the performing arts.
